    1. Stable Power Output for Consistent Imaging

    Stable power output ensures consistent imaging quality. Fluctuations in power can lead to distortions or inaccuracies. Advanced systems are designed to deliver stable voltage and current, maintaining image clarity and reliability across various operating conditions.

    2. High-Frequency Power Conversion

    Modern systems use high-frequency power conversion techniques to improve efficiency and reduce energy loss. These technologies enable faster response times and better control over imaging processes, resulting in improved performance and reduced operational costs.

    3. Precision Control of Beam Output

    Accurate control of X-ray beam intensity and focus is essential for high-quality imaging. Advanced systems provide precise control mechanisms, allowing operators to adjust parameters according to specific requirements. This ensures optimal results for different applications.

    4. Reduced Noise and Improved Signal Quality

    Noise reduction is critical for achieving clear images. Advanced power systems minimize electrical noise, ensuring high signal quality. This improves image resolution and enhances the overall effectiveness of imaging systems.

    5. Energy Efficiency and Sustainability

    Energy-efficient designs reduce power consumption while maintaining high performance. This not only lowers operational costs but also supports sustainable practices, making modern imaging systems environmentally friendly.

    Powering Precision: The Impact of Advanced Power Technologies on Imaging Systems

    Power technologies are the backbone of imaging systems, directly influencing performance, reliability, and efficiency. Advanced solutions ensure optimal operation and high-quality results.

    1. High Voltage Stability for Accurate Imaging

    Stable high-voltage output is essential for generating consistent X-ray beams. This stability ensures accurate imaging and reliable results across applications.

    2. Low Ripple and Noise for Clarity

    Low ripple and noise levels improve image quality by reducing distortions. Advanced power supplies are designed to deliver clean and stable outputs, enhancing imaging precision.

    3. Fast Response and Control

    Quick response times enable efficient operation and precise adjustments. This improves system performance and reduces delays in imaging processes.

    4. Compatibility with Various Systems

    Modern power technologies are compatible with different imaging systems, ensuring flexibility and adaptability across applications.

    5. Robust Design for Reliability

    Durable designs ensure long-term reliability, even in demanding environments. This reduces maintenance requirements and enhances system performance.
